Overview

When comparing the DEWALT 20V MAX Jig Saw and the DEKOPRO 20V Power Jigsaw, it's clear that both tools cater to different user needs and budgets. The DEWALT model, priced at $169.34, is aimed at professionals and serious DIY enthusiasts, while the DEKOPRO model offers a budget-friendly alternative at just $49.99. This price difference of about 70% reflects the DEWALT's higher performance capabilities and features.

Performance

The DEWALT 20V MAX Jig Saw delivers impressive performance with a maximum blade speed of 3,200 strokes per minute (spm). This is significantly higher than the DEKOPRO's maximum speed of 3,000 RPM, providing a slight edge for the DEWALT in terms of cutting efficiency. The DEWALT's brushless motor enhances runtime and efficiency, making it suitable for prolonged use on demanding projects. Conversely, while the DEKOPRO is adequate for basic DIY tasks, its performance may not meet the rigorous demands of professional applications.

Features

In terms of features, the DEWALT model stands out with its superior design elements, such as an all-metal, lever-action keyless blade change for quick swaps, and a 4-position orbital action for versatile cutting. The DEKOPRO does offer a tool-less blade clamp, which allows for easy blade changes without tools, but lacks the advanced orbital settings of the DEWALT. The integrated LED light in both models enhances visibility during use; however, the DEWALT's overall feature set is more robust, catering to a wider range of cutting scenarios.

Design and Build Quality

The DEWALT 20V MAX Jig Saw is designed with a compact size for easy grip and maximum control, which is beneficial for intricate cuts. Its durable build, including a no-mar shoe cover, ensures it protects work surfaces from scratches. In contrast, the DEKOPRO features a metal base plate that is adjustable for bevel cuts but does not match the DEWALT's overall sturdiness and advanced engineering. This difference in build quality is significant, especially for users who prioritize durability in their tools.

User Experience

User experience with the DEWALT 20V MAX Jig Saw is enhanced by its integrated dust blower, which helps keep the cutting line clear, making it easier to follow cut lines accurately. This feature is particularly useful for detailed work where precision is critical. The DEKOPRO model does include a dust port adapter for vacuum attachment, improving visibility during cuts, but it may not be as effective as the DEWALT’s dedicated dust blower. Overall, the DEWALT provides a more professional and user-friendly experience.

Included Accessories

When it comes to included accessories, the DEKOPRO 20V Power Jigsaw offers a comprehensive kit that includes multiple blades, a hex key, a parallel guide ruler, and a dust-blowing port adapter, along with a 2000mAh battery and charger. This makes it an attractive option for beginners who need everything in one package. In contrast, the DEWALT is sold as a bare tool, meaning users will need to purchase batteries and chargers separately, which could add to the overall cost.
